    How to handle large snmpwalk result

    I'm trying to move from lots of snmpget requests to one single snmpwalk, from which I can build dependent items.

    Unfortunately, the snmpwalk output is 489946 characters which exceeds the TEXT limit of Zabbix. Does anyone know if there are any plans to support larger text block sizes? mysql and mariadb have MEDIUMTEXT and LONGTEXT which are more than capable of handling this

    When using dependent items, you don't actually need to save the master item at all (= history can be set to 0). If you don't save the master item, does the large data still cause some problems to you?

      Oh, that's looking promising. I'll see what it's like when I've rebuilt a couple of the discovery rules.

      The only main differences seem to be
      • I can't use the "last updated" trigger on the master object, because it never stores a new value
      • the dependent item graphs are points and not lines when you look at time ranges less than 1 day.
